Curtain lifted on Sonic RPG

Bioware’s Sonic Chronicles: The Dark Brotherhood hitting DS this year

Sega has at last revealed the name of Bioware’s upcoming DS Sonic RPG – Sonic Chronicles: The Dark Brotherhood. The title will be released on Nintendo’s handheld some time before the end of the year.

Bioware has enjoyed tremendous RPG success in the past with hits such as Star Wars: Knights of the Old Republic, Jade Empire, Baldur’s Gate, Neverwinter Nights and recent Xbox 360 hit Mass Effect.

This game will be the latest in a long line of Western-orientated titles from Sega, the most recent being Bizarre Creations’ The Club on Xbox 360 and PS3 earlier this month.

As part of Sega’s Western push it has also acquired the likes of The Creative Assembly and Sports Interactive, and founded UK-based developer Sega Racing Studio.
